Document issued to nationals of: IMN - Isle of Man • BRITISH ISLANDS ISLE OF MAN •
Isle of Man is not a full member of the European Union. Some holders of Isle of Man passports are full EU citizens by virtue of their links with the United Kingdom. Other holders are not full EU citizens, and will have an endorsement on the Observations page of their passport stating that the holder is not entitled to benefit from EU provisions relating to employment or establishment: "The holder is not entitled to benefit from EC/EU provisions relating to employment or establishment".

Security features:
Additional safeguard
laser-perforated fine structures and designs on biodata page
The biodata page contains five differing designs of laser-perforated fine structures and designs in different positions; three patterns are shown.
